Source: Alar: Kannada-English corpusGhaṭṭigoḷ (ಘಟ್ಟಿಗೊಳ್):—
1) [verb] to become solid, compact, etc.; to solidify.
2) [verb] to become firm, hard or strong.
3) [verb] (an idea) to become firmly convinced.
